Fixed 3.3V boost converter for single-cell portable designs

The Texas Instruments TPS61261DRVT is a step-up (boost) DC-DC converter with a fixed 3.3V output, delivering up to 100mA from an input voltage range of 0.8V to 4V. It integrates a synchronous rectifier, which improves efficiency at light loads compared to a diode-based boost — a meaningful difference when the load current varies widely, as it does in battery-powered sensor nodes. The 2.5MHz switching frequency lets the designer use small, low-profile inductors and ceramic capacitors, keeping the total solution area under 10 mm² in many layouts.
